If you are already in Google Earth on web you can click on the ship's wheel on the left hand navigation menu. WebFirst enter Street View mode in desktop Google Maps. Notice the overlay in the upper-right corner with the address and Street View date, and next to the date is a clock-cycle icon. Click that icon to pick a different date. WebNov 1, 2024 · How do I change the date in Google Earth 2024? Click View and then click Historical Imagery. You can also locate the clock icon above the 3D view option and click it for quick access. Choose the time period you wish to view. Google will show the available options as well.
